Key Warehouse Challenges Across Industries

Manual Monitoring and Documentation Gaps

Paper logs and manual checks introduce errors, missed readings, and incomplete audit trails. These gaps increase inspection risk and consume valuable operational time.

Seemoto automates data capture, creating continuous, validated records stored securely in the Seemoto Cloud for long-term traceability.

Environmental Fluctuations and Product Risk

Large warehouse volumes are prone to uneven airflow, door activity, and seasonal temperature swings. These variations can degrade pharmaceuticals, frozen foods, electronics, and chemical materials.

Real-time monitoring and alerts detect deviations early, enabling corrective action before product quality or safety is compromised.

Energy Inefficiency and ​Hidden Costs

HVAC and refrigeration systems represent a major cost driver. Undetected inefficiencies lead to rising energy consumption and unexpected equipment failures.

Seemoto’s analytics highlight performance trends, door activity, and environmental patterns, supporting energy optimization and predictive maintenance.

Increasing Compliance Pressure

Warehouses operating under GDP, GMP, or food safety regulations must maintain continuous documentation while reducing manual workloads.

Automated, audit-ready reports simplify inspections and ensure full traceability across all storage zones and facilities.

Commonly asked questions

What types of warehouses can use Seemoto’s monitoring system?

Seemoto is suitable for pharmaceutical, food, logistics, e-commerce, healthcare, and industrial warehouses—any environment that requires accurate and reliable monitoring of temperature and/or humidity.

Can the system monitor multiple zones or rooms within a warehouse?

Absolutely. Seemoto supports multi-zone and multi-room configurations, enabling you to track ambient conditions in various storage areas, cold rooms, and buffer zones—all from a single dashboard.

What happens if the network connection or power supply is interrupted?

Seemoto sensors are battery-operated and store data locally during connectivity outages. Once the gateway reconnects, all buffered data is automatically uploaded to the cloud—ensuring no data loss.

How are temperature excursions handled in the warehouse?

If a temperature excursion occurs, Seemoto immediately triggers SMS and/or email alerts to designated personnel. The system includes alert handling tools and audit reports for efficient corrective action and compliance tracking.

How long is the monitoring data stored and how can it be accessed?

All monitoring data is stored in the Seemoto cloud service for a minimum of 5 years, and can be accessed anytime via web interface or mobile apps. Reports can be exported in PDF, Excel, or CSV formats.
